
La automatización del flujo de trabajo a menudo se describe como "conectar pasos entre sí".
En realidad, los sistemas de flujo de trabajo modernos impulsados por IA se comportan menos como flujos lineales y más como motores de orquestación distribuida.
Coordinan tareas, datos, decisiones y excepciones en múltiples sistemas, a menudo en paralelo, a menudo de forma asincrónica y rara vez en línea recta.
Este artículo explica la automatización del flujo de trabajo con IA desde una perspectiva de orquestación en lugar de una vista del proceso paso a paso.
De flujos de trabajo secuenciales a sistemas orquestados
Las herramientas de automatización tradicionales asumen un orden predecible:
Tarea A → Tarea B → Tarea C.
La automatización del flujo de trabajo impulsada por IA reemplaza esta suposición con una lógica de orquestación:
-
las tareas pueden ejecutarse simultáneamente
-
las decisiones pueden ramificarse dinámicamente
-
los datos pueden llegar desordenados
-
los fallos deben aislarse y recuperarse
La responsabilidad del sistema pasa de “ejecutar pasos” a coordinar el comportamiento de las partes móviles.
La pila de capas de orquestación
Una IA de automatización del flujo de trabajo normalmente opera en varias capas:
Capa de eventos
Captura señales como envíos de formularios, actualizaciones de datos, resultados de agentes o activadores externos.
Capa de decisión
Evalúa las condiciones mediante reglas, modelos o inferencia de IA para determinar qué debería suceder a continuación.
Capa de ejecución
Ejecuta tareas a través de agentes, API, automatización del navegador o trabajos en segundo plano.
Capa de coordinación
Garantiza que se respeten las dependencias, que las tareas paralelas se sincronicen y que los resultados se enruten correctamente.
Capa de recuperación
Maneja reintentos, respaldos, reversiones y enrutamiento de excepciones cuando falla la ejecución.
Cada capa funciona de forma independiente pero se rige por una lógica de orquestación compartida.
Tipos de nodos dentro de un flujo de trabajo de IA
En lugar de “pasos”, los sistemas de orquestación operan en nodos, cada uno con una función específica:
-
Los nodos desencadenantes inician flujos de trabajo
-
Nodos de decisión evalúan condiciones o resultados de IA
-
Nodos de acción realizan tareas
-
Nodos de agregación esperan a que se completen varias ramas
-
Los nodos de retardo introducen una lógica basada en el tiempo
-
Nodos de terminación cierran flujos de trabajo
Los motores de flujo de trabajo de IA seleccionan y secuencian dinámicamente estos nodos según el contexto del tiempo de ejecución.
Puertas de enlace de eventos y enrutamiento condicional
En el centro de la orquestación se encuentra la puerta de enlace de eventos.
Una puerta de enlace de eventos:
-
escucha señales
-
evalúa el estado
-
rutas de ejecución de rutas
Las decisiones de enrutamiento pueden depender de:
-
integridad de los datos
-
puntuaciones de confianza
-
comportamiento del usuario
-
respuestas del sistema externo
Esto permite que los flujos de trabajo se adapten en tiempo real en lugar de seguir una ruta predeterminada.
Ejecución y sincronización paralela
Muchos flujos de trabajo empresariales requieren que las tareas se ejecuten simultáneamente:
-
enriquecimiento de datos
-
preparación para la divulgación
-
comprobaciones de validación
-
generación de documentos
IA de automatización del flujo de trabajo lanza estas tareas en paralelo y luego sincroniza los resultados mediante la lógica de agregación.
El sistema debe gestionar:
-
finalización parcial
-
tiempos de espera
-
resolución de dependencia
-
resultados inconsistentes
La orquestación garantiza que el flujo de trabajo avance solo cuando se cumplen las condiciones requeridas.
Conciencia del Estado y lógica de transición
Cada instancia de flujo de trabajo mantiene un estado interno:
-
iniciado
-
esperando
-
ejecutando
-
bloqueado
-
completado
-
falló
La orquestación impulsada por IA rastrea las transiciones de estado continuamente, lo que permite:
-
ajustes a mitad del proceso
-
redireccionamiento en caso de error
-
escalamiento condicional
-
ejecución diferida
Esta conciencia del estado es lo que permite que los flujos de trabajo sigan siendo resistentes en lugar de frágiles.
Rutas de recuperación y manejo de fallos
El fracaso es esperado, no excepcional.
La IA de automatización del flujo de trabajo incorpora lógica de recuperación como:
-
reintentar con retroceso
-
rutas de ejecución alternativas
-
reversión parcial
-
escalada humana en el circuito
Los fallos se aíslan a nivel de nodo para evitar el colapso total del flujo de trabajo.
Este enfoque refleja el diseño de sistemas distribuidos en lugar de simples scripts de automatización.
Dónde encaja SaleAI en esta arquitectura
Dentro de SaleAI:
-
Los agentes actúan como nodos de ejecución
-
Agentes de navegador manejan tareas interactivas
-
Agentes de datos realizan enriquecimiento y validación
-
Lógica de decisión enruta los flujos de trabajo basados en resultados de IA
-
Centro de operaciones coordina la orquestación entre sistemas
SaleAI funciona como una capa de orquestación en lugar de una herramienta de automatización lineal.
Esta explicación refleja el comportamiento del sistema, no afirmaciones de rendimiento.
Por qué es importante la orquestación para la automatización empresarial
A medida que las operaciones escalan, los flujos de trabajo se vuelven:
-
menos predecible
-
más basado en datos
-
más asincrónico
-
más dependiente de los resultados de la IA
La automatización basada en orquestación permite que los sistemas se adapten, recuperen y evolucionen sin un rediseño manual constante.
Es la diferencia entre automatizar tareas y automatizar sistemas.
Perspectiva final
La IA para la automatización del flujo de trabajo no consiste en reemplazar el esfuerzo humano con secuencias de comandos.
Se trata de coordinar la inteligencia, la ejecución y la toma de decisiones en entornos operativos complejos.
Entender la automatización como orquestación aclara por qué los sistemas de flujo de trabajo de IA modernos se comportan de manera diferente y por qué escalan donde fallan los flujos de trabajo tradicionales.
